Insider Selling: Mirum Pharmaceuticals (NASDAQ:MIRM) CEO Sells $2,960,400.00 in Stock

Mirum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(NASDAQ:MIRMGet Free Report) CEO Christopher Peetz sold 30,000 shares of the business’s stock in a transaction dated Tuesday, September 1st. The shares were sold at an average price of $98.68, for a total transaction of $2,960,400.00. Following the completion of the transaction, the chief executive officer owned 194,440 shares in the company, valued at $19,187,339.20. The trade was a 13.37%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a legal fil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available through this hyperlink.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.

About Mirum Pharmaceuticals

(Get Free Report)

Mirum Pharmaceuticals, Inc is a late-stage biopharmaceutical company dedicated to the development and commercialization of innovative therapies for rare cholestatic liver diseases. The company’s primary focus lies in addressing the unmet medical needs of patients suffering from genetic and progressive forms of pediatric liver disorders, where limited treatment options currently exist.

Mirum’s lead product candidate, maralixibat (Livmarli), is an ileal bile acid transporter inhibitor designed to reduce systemic bile acid accumulation and alleviate associated pruritus and liver damage.
